Section courante

A propos

Section administrative du site

REALLOC

Réallocation
Turbo C++ stdlib.h

Syntaxe

void *realloc(void *block, size_t size);

Paramètres

Nom Description
block Ce paramètre permet d'indiquer un pointeur vers un bloc de mémoire alloué avec malloc, calloc ou realloc. Si block est NULL, realloc agit comme malloc(size). Si size est 0 et block n'est pas NULL, alors realloc libère la mémoire et retourne NULL.
size Ce paramètre permet d'indiquer la nouvelle taille du bloc mémoire (en octets). Si la nouvelle taille est plus grande, le contenu précédent est conservé autant que possible. Si la nouvelle taille est plus petite, les données excédentaires peuvent être perdues.

Description

Cette fonction permet de changer la taille d'un bloc de mémoire dynamique.



Dernière mise à jour : Dimanche, le 28 Février 2021